Festo SFAB Series Flow Sensor, 10 l/min Minimum Flow Rate, 1000 l/min Maximum Flow Rate - SFAB-1000U-WQ10-2SA-M12, Numeric Part Number: 565407
This flow sensor is a critical device designed for air flow measurement in various industrial applications. Capable of monitoring volumetric flow rates between 10 l/min and 1000 l/min, it provides accurate data under varying pressure conditions. Its robust construction with polyamide housing ensures durability, while an illuminated LCD display enhances user interaction. The flow sensor operates efficiently within a temperature range of 0°C to +50°C, making it suitable for various environments.

How does the thermal measurement principle improve performance?
The thermal measurement principle allows for accurate detection of flow changes, ensuring reliable data is provided even at varying flow rates. This contributes to efficient system control and monitoring.
What protection features ensure durability in harsh environments?
The IP65 rating safeguards against dust and moisture, while the robust polyamide housing offers protection from mechanical wear, making it suitable for use in challenging industrial settings.
Can it be mounted in different orientations?
Yes, the flow sensor is designed for optional mounting positions, allowing flexibility based on specific installation requirements. This versatility enhances its usability across various applications.
